neosnippet.vim/neosnippets/coffee.snip

73 lines
1.2 KiB
Plaintext
Raw Normal View History

2012-02-02 04:33:35 +00:00
snippet req
2012-10-30 08:53:14 +00:00
${1:#:object} = require('$1')
2012-02-02 04:33:35 +00:00
snippet log
console.log ${0}
snippet unl
2012-10-30 08:53:14 +00:00
${1:#:action} unless ${2:#:condition}
2012-02-02 04:33:35 +00:00
snippet try
try
2012-10-30 08:53:14 +00:00
${1:TARGET}
catch ${2:#:error}
2012-02-02 04:33:35 +00:00
${3}
snippet if
2012-10-30 08:53:14 +00:00
if ${1:#:condition}
${0:TARGET}
2012-02-02 04:33:35 +00:00
snippet elif
2012-10-30 08:53:14 +00:00
else if ${1:#:condition}
${0:TARGET}
2012-02-02 04:33:35 +00:00
snippet ifte
2012-10-30 08:53:14 +00:00
if ${1:#:condition} then ${2:#:value} else ${3:#:other}
2012-02-02 04:33:35 +00:00
snippet ife
2012-10-30 08:53:14 +00:00
if ${1:#:condition}
${2:TARGET}
2012-02-02 04:33:35 +00:00
else
2012-10-30 08:53:14 +00:00
${3:#:body...}
2012-02-02 04:33:35 +00:00
snippet swi
2012-10-30 08:53:14 +00:00
switch ${1:#:object}
when ${2:#:value}
${0:TARGET}
2012-02-02 04:33:35 +00:00
snippet ^j
\`${1:javascript}\`
snippet forr
2012-10-30 08:53:14 +00:00
for ${1:#:name} in [${2:#:start}..${3:#:finish}]${4: by ${5:#:step\}}
${0:TARGET}
2012-02-02 04:33:35 +00:00
snippet forrex
2012-10-30 08:53:14 +00:00
for ${1:#:name} in [${2:#:start}...${3:#:finish}]${4: by ${5:#:step\}}
${0:TARGET}
2012-02-02 04:33:35 +00:00
snippet foro
2012-10-30 08:53:14 +00:00
for ${1:#:key}, ${2:#:value} of ${3:#:object}
${0:TARGET}
2012-02-02 04:33:35 +00:00
snippet fora
2012-10-30 08:53:14 +00:00
for ${1:#:name} in ${2:#:array}
${0:TARGET}
2012-02-02 04:33:35 +00:00
snippet fun
2012-10-30 08:53:14 +00:00
${1:#:name} = (${2:#:args}) ->
${0:TARGET}
2012-02-02 04:33:35 +00:00
snippet bfun
2012-10-30 08:53:14 +00:00
(${1:#:args}) =>
${0:TARGET}
2012-02-02 04:33:35 +00:00
snippet cla
abbr cla
2012-10-21 12:13:26 +00:00
options head
2012-10-30 08:53:14 +00:00
class ${1:#:ClassName}${2: extends ${3:#:Ancestor\}}
2012-02-02 04:33:35 +00:00
2012-10-30 08:53:14 +00:00
constructor: (${4:#:args}) ->
${5:TARGET}
2012-02-02 04:33:35 +00:00